GOP Candidate Rakes In Massive Fundraising Haul…In Suburban Seattle

Republican front-runner Dino Rossi hauled in more than $575,000 in donations just nine days after kicking off his campaign to replace retiring Rep. Dave Reichert in Washington’s 8th District.

Rossi doubled the fundraising of any of his opponents in the third filing quarter. The next-closest candidate, pediatrician Kim Schrier, a Democrat, raised a shade under $275,000.

The donations to Rossi’s campaign flowed in from the day of his announcement, Sept. 21, to the end of the quarter on Sept. 30, an average of more than $64,000 per day (and $2,680 per hour) during the span.

“I hoped we’d get off to a strong start, but I didn’t know for sure how people would react,” Rossi wrote in a Facebook post to his supporters last week.
